Global Leadership Ogilvy's position as the #1 global agency network for creative excellence and effectiveness signifies strong brand authority and a proven track record of delivering impactful solutions, providing opportunities to offer advanced marketing technologies and data-driven tools to maintain and enhance their leadership position.
Multinational Presence With over 120 offices across nearly 90 countries, Ogilvy presents extensive geographical reach, making it a prime candidate for localized and region-specific digital solutions, media buying platforms, and cross-border campaign management tools.
Innovation Focus Ogilvy's emphasis on Borderless Creativity and integration of diverse capabilities highlights openness to adopting innovative tech stacks and creative platforms, creating opportunities to introduce cutting-edge advertising, analytics, and visualization tools that support their creative initiatives.
Financial Scale With revenue exceeding 10 billion dollars and a large employee base, Ogilvy's considerable financial and operational capacity can facilitate partnerships for enterprise-scale advertising solutions, comprehensive marketing automation, and global data management systems.
Recent Industry Recognition Ogilvy's consistent recognition for creativity and effectiveness, including top rankings on WARC lists and awards at international festivals, indicates a dedicated investment in high-quality content creation, which could be complemented by premium creative SaaS products and analytics platforms to sustain their competitive edge.